Considering Saswata and Bijoya’ s proposed inclusion of questions in the Field questionnaire, I am proposing some questions which may be relevant for the purpose:
For the Panchayat Secretary:
1. Do you have any data on migrating people in your GP before the implementation of NREGS ? yes/no
2. If yes , please provide the data.
3. Which types of people are migrating from your GP?
4. Do you think that tendency of migration has reduced after the implementation of NREGS from your GP?
5. If no, why?
6. Do you have any development plan under NREGS?
For the Gram Panchayat members:
1. Do you know the priority areas of work under the NREGS scheme? Yes/no
2. If yes please mention some of those ( at least five):
3. What are the major features of ‘100 days work’ ( please tick)
a. To provide every adult members volunteer to do unskilled manual work
b. To provide not less than 100 days in a financial year
c. disbursement of daily wages on a weekly basis
d. wage not less than 60 rupees per day
e. villagers should give work within 15 days after application
f. If not he/she will be entitled to unemployment allowance
g. scheme to be implemented by GP based on the recommendation of Gram Sanshad
h. Gram shabha shall monitor execution of work
i. Creation of durable assets
j. At least on third of the beneficiaries shall be women who have registered and requested to work
k. At least fourteen days continuous work
l. Employment should within five km radius of the village
4. Do the people of your Gram Sanshad migrate for work after implantation of NREGS?
5. If yes, why?
6. Do you think that implementation of NREGS is helpful in arresting out migration?
7. If no, why?
8. As a representative, are you facing any difficulty in getting work for everybody within limited opportunities under NREGS?
9. Or, How do you manage if the number of villagers who intend to work are more than the mandays created the NREGS? Is there any preference of selection ?
For the Household members:
I think whenever one ask questions among villagers on NREGS , one should refer ‘100 days work’ instead of NREGS because people are more acquainted with the former term.
Instead of approaching questions about ‘100 days work’ as proposed by Saswata , we may start like:
1. Do you know the’100days work’? yes/no
2. If yes , from where you got the information first ?
3. What are the major features of ‘100 days work’ ( please tick)
a. To provide every adult members volunteer to do unskilled manual work
b. To provide not less than 100 days in a financial year
c. disbursement of daily wages on a weekly basis
d. wage not less than 60 rupees per day
e. villagers should give work within 15 days after application
f. If not he/she will be entitled to unemployment allowance
g. scheme to be implemented by GP based on the recommendation of Gram Sanshad
h. Gram shabha shall monitor execution of work
i. Creation of durable assets
j. At least on third of the beneficiaries shall be women who have registered and requested to work
k. At least fourteen days continuous work
l. Employment should within five km radius of the village
4. Have you applied for job card ?
5. If yes, after how many days of application for NREGS, the job card issued?
6. Have you got job under ‘100 days work’ ?
7. If yes , for how many days ?
8. What type of work you have done under the scheme ? Is other family member engaged in this activity?
9. Is it within your village ?
10. If no where? What is the distance?
11. How much wage you got? In cash?
12. When you got wage after work?
13. Do you usually go other places for work before the implementation of ‘100 days work’ ?
14. Are you still going to other places for work after the implementation of ‘100 days work’ ?
15. Do you think the scheme is worthwhile for the development of village?
16. Whether assets created under the scheme , properly maintained?
17. How you spend your after getting money from the scheme?
18. Do you think that income from the scheme by the male members of the family is properly utilized ( addressed to women members of the family)?
For non NREGS members:
1. Why you haven’t applied for job card?
2. Do you think that whatever assets created under the scheme in the village is useful for village development?
3. Whether assets created under the scheme, properly maintained?
4. Do you think that income from the scheme is helpful to maintain the daily needs of the concerned family?
These are in addition to basic demographic and socio economic data to be prepared the students discussed in the last class.
